I like everything about this electric shaver. So far, I have shaved 3 times. So keep my limited experience in mind for my review. -- It is not too heavy. It is not too light. Goldilocks would say it is just right. -- It is easy to grip. It has a good shape to grasp. -- It initially sounded a bit too noisy (I never used an electric shaver before). But it is not loud. It is a bit noisy, but nothing that you should find unpleasant. -- It gives my face a close shave (not the closest, but darn close). However, it depends on the hair. If it is rough, then this shaver works great. If it is fine, then this shaver will struggle. Fine hair will bend and fold, and that means that it will not go into the foil cover's holes for the blades to cut it. So I still use a disposable razor for my neck. But for my beard and mustache, it works great. And it will not cut you. So there is no worrying about that. -- I initially tried it with close to 10 days worth of facial growth. It is not designed for that, and did nearly nothing. But if you shave daily, or even skip a day (which is what I do), it works great. -- The manual states to fully charge it before using it. I did. I decided to test how long a full charge would last. I purchased this on March 27, 2025. I have been shaving with it every-other-day, since then. The LED light, today, October 17, 2025, flashed that the batter is low. And even with it flashing, it shaved like it was fully charged (no sign of slowing down). I am impressed. The manufacturer definitely used a quality battery. -- There are four battery strength bars. According to the manual, when the last bar starts blinking, you have 10 minutes left. At full charge, it is supposed to last 3 hours. -- For my shaves, it did not heat up. -- It is simple to remove the cap to expose the blades. That allows you to run some water over the blades to clean off the shavings. You can also rinse out the cap, which will have shavings. It takes 3 to 5 seconds to rinse off everything. You do not have to touch anything. Then you let it air dry. The manual warns against using a blow drier. So let it air dry. -- The manual warns to not use it when it is wet. -- The manual warns to not submerge the shaver under water. But rinsing is fine. I would think twice about using it in the shower. -- Not mentioned in the listing (and this goes for all electric foil shavers) is that you should oil the blades after every use. The manual goes on to read that not doing so will void the warranty. -- The oil is not included. So if you do not have oil, add it to your basket. -- The rechargeable battery is not replaceable. So whenever the built-in battery gets too old to hold a charge, the shaver becomes a brick -- sort of. It should still work while plugged in. But that is not clear. -- I had a question about its built-in battery. I called their customer service number (it is in the manual). After waiting 12 minutes, I was connected to a polite agent. But rather than telling me whether or not the battery was replaceable, she kept repeating that if it dies under the 2-year warranty, they will ship a new one. I was asking her about replacing the battery after the 2-year warranty period, and it was going in circles. Either she did not know the answer, and did not want to say that she did not know, or she was told / trained to focus on the warranty. But I politely made my question clear, and she eventually said that after 2 years, the unit would need to be recycled. That was the best answer I was able to obtain from her. There was no mention of a battery replacement in the manual. -- The foil and the blades are replaceable I do not know how simple or tedious that would be. It is probably not difficult, based on the rest of the shaver's very good design. I hope that the blades and the foils hold up for the long run. But for now, I like everything about this shaver (other than not being able to replace its built-in, rechargeable battery).

This is a great machine. Well built, quiet, powerful. But behind the chair, they slowed me down.The throw feels shorter than Im used to and the guards, while super secure, take a bit to get on. When doing bald fades I usually clean up the blend with my 0.5 guard, but I couldn't get it seamless. Too much difference in length, possibly because of the shorter throw? I think if you are a pro that either likes to take your time, or simply has the time this tool requires, this is the clipper for you. I'm in a busy walk in shop and I just don't have time to fumble with this. I switched out to LoProFX and now I'm back on track. I'm giving 5 stars because this is really a good machine, just not good for what I do.

Finally a shaver that does the job. I’ve gone through 3 other ones and finally decided to try this one. Well worth the money! You get what you pay for. Finally I can shave and not have to use a razor after. I have quite thick stubble and finding a shaver that would work has been difficult. This one makes fast work and leaves a shave that’s feels as close as my razor. Even on 2 day stubble it works great although takes a bit longer, but the motor is strong enough to deal with that. Since I got it and charged the battery I haven’t had to recharge it as of yet. Been roughly a month. So Battery life is good. Feels smooth on the skin also and doesn’t pull even on 2 day growth. Great shaver overall and does the job I’ve been looking for. No negatives at this time although I do wonder if I can buy replacement blades when the time comes? And where to buy those.
